Remarks

My college was affiliated with GGSIPU till 2019. So, I took addmission from GGSIPU counselling and on the basis of JEE MAIN RANK and got this college in the counselling the main reason for selecting this college is because its a Govt. College and has very low fees compared to other private colleges, But Now our college is turned into NSUT East Campus So, its fee structure has been changed and become 4times higher than previously. But also the upcoming students will get benefits as of NSUT Main Campus Students get.

Course Curriculum Overview

5

I wanted to opt B.Tech (CSE) but due to cutoff i was unable to get that branch so, I opted ECE Branch and got admission in this college. Our college provides two course B.Tech and M.Tech for there are two branches in B.Tech (CSE,ECE) and 5 braches in M.Tech. Till 2019 batch our college follows the guidelines of GGSIPU but for upcoming batches they have to follow guidelines provided by NSUT Main Campus. All the teachers are well qualified and mostly are PHDs and recruited by AICTE under Govt. of Delhi. Most of the teachers are permanent but as a govt college their is a lack of some teacher but to fufill them their are contractual based teachers which are also well qualified. All teachers are very kind and helping in nature.

Placement Experience

2.5

The placement is average most of the students get placed but the annual average package is about 4-5lakh/year. There are infosys, wipro tech,etc comapnies which comes here. No, Product Based or StartUp comapnies visits here, just some service base comapnies visits here till now also there is very less or no internship offered from the college side, as it become the East Campus of NSUT the upcoming students will be allowed to seat in NSUT placements and placement record will improve and will be increased in coming years.

College Events

3.5

Their is one technical and cultural fest happens in our college where you can win lots of rewards based on you skills but their is less crowd from outside the college except the participants. Also their are lots of societies and clubs where you get some extra skills by participating in them.Campus life is good very less crowd, good infrastructure with a very big ground, dedicated parking available. Boys to Girls Ratio 7:1. There is also a room dedicated for Table Tennis, court for badminton and volleyball also their is a court for basket ball. location is not very good, transportation problem for students not having their own vehicle, and also now it became EAST CAMPUS OF NSUT so things will improve.

Fee Structure And Facilities

When I took addmission back in 2019 I had payed 40000 to freeze my seat and no more fees i have pay after that, and for the batches till 2019 the fee was around 40,000 but for the batches from 2020 onwards the fee structure will vary and will be around 4 times higher, because it is now affiliated with NSUT East Campus and the addmission will be taken through JAC.Our college does not provide any internship and no comapnies visit college for internship till now but it may change for the batches 2020 and onwards. Average annual package received by the students in campus placements are b/w 3-5lacs but outside the campus you can get even more. So, their very less opportunities of jobs in this college till now as it is affiliated with GGSIPU.

Hostel Facilities

2.5

Our college does not provide any Hostel facility till now but there are many P.Gs nearby which are available at 10k for two students per month. Our college has canteen where you can enjoy food, also their are many food stalls outside the college. Locality is average it is situated in Geeta Colony which is crowded and all the facilities are available, nearest metro stations are Shastri Park, Laxmi Nagar.
